Key concepts in Synthesis, evaluation and skills

Key Idea: Topic 13.5 is the synthesis, evaluation and skills strand of Option G — it is about reading urban information accurately off maps and graphs and quoting it back with the right figures and units. It rests on one micro: 13.5.1 — urban geographic skills: maps and graphs: the two core skills are cartographic (reading a topographic or street map — a feature at a grid reference, a six-figure reference, a compass direction, a distance off the scale) and graphical (reading a value, a difference between peaks, or a trend with figures off an urban graph such as a congestion index, a land-value gradient or a density transect). This is an Option G topic, examined on Paper 1 — you answer only the options you studied (SL answers 2, HL answers 3, the same questions). Marks are awarded for precise, correctly-quoted figures with units, not for explanation — and these skills also feed the structured questions and the [10] extended-answer essay, where you must apply data you have read to a real urban argument.

🗺️ 13.5.1 — Reading urban maps: grid references, direction, scale

On a topographic or street map of a real city you read a feature at a grid reference, give a six-figure grid reference (square first, then tenths), state a compass direction between two places, and use the scale to estimate a distance in km. The golden rule is order: eastings first (read across), northings second (read up) — 'along the corridor, then up the stairs'. Each read is marked on its own, so the skill is speed with accuracy — spot the read, do it cleanly, quote the figure with its unit, move on.

The four core map reads — and the method

ReadMethodWorked check
Feature at a grid referenceFind the easting column, then the northing row — read what is in that squareE19 N12 -> Riverside School
Six-figure grid referenceFind the four-figure square, then estimate tenths across (easting) and up (northing)4 across, 5 up in square 1911 -> 194115
Compass direction A to BStand at A, face B — read N/NE/E/SE/S/SW/W/NW from the way you travelport -> hospital, straight across -> east (E)
Distance A to BMeasure the straight line in cm, then multiply by the scale value4 cm at 1:50 000 -> 4 x 0.5 = 2 km

Key terms — cartographic skills

  • Grid reference — numbers locating a place: eastings (read across) first, then northings (read up).
  • Four-figure grid reference — names a whole grid square (e.g. 1911).
  • Six-figure grid reference — pins an exact point by splitting each square into tenths (e.g. 194115).
  • Scale — the ratio of map to real distance: 1:50 000 means 1 cm = 0.5 km; 1:25 000 means 1 cm = 0.25 km.
  • Compass direction (bearing) — N, NE, E, SE, S, SW, W, NW between two points; stand at the start and face the end.
  • Topographic map — a map showing features (relief, roads, buildings) of an urban area, read using the grid and scale.
Tip: Read the easting (across) before the northing (up), and the square before the tenths. For a six-figure reference: find the four-figure square, then estimate how far across (easting tenths) and up (northing tenths) the point sits, and write the easting digits then the northing digits. Swapping the order is the single most common skills mistake.

📈 13.5.1 — Reading urban graphs: values, peaks, trends

Option G also gives urban graphs — a congestion index, a land-value gradient, a population-density transect, or a pollution time-series. The skill is always the same: read a value off the correct axis, calculate a difference between two points, or describe the trend with figures. A value alone is not enough — a graph read scores only when you quote the exact figure with its unit, or, for a difference, the subtraction of two peak values. A vague trend word ('goes up and down') scores nothing.

Read the y-axis first. Find the day on the x-axis, go up to the line, read the index across — then subtract two peaks for a difference or describe the trend with figures.

The three core graph reads — and the method

ReadMethodWorked check
Read a valueFind the day/time on the x-axis, go up to the line/bar, read the y-axis value acrossThursday morning peak -> 66
Calculate a differenceRead both peak values, then subtract the smaller from the largerFri evening 88 - Wed evening 69 = 19
Describe a trendGive the overall direction PLUS figures (the peak day and its value)rises through the week, peaking Friday at 88

Key terms — graphical skills

  • Time-series graph — a line/bar graph with time on the x-axis (e.g. a congestion index over a week).
  • Value — the figure read off the y-axis for a given point on the x-axis (quote it with its unit).
  • Peak — the highest point of a line/series; name the day/time it occurs and its value.
  • Difference — one value subtracted from another (e.g. one peak minus another peak).
  • Trend — the overall direction the data moves (rising, falling, fluctuating) — always backed with figures.
  • Land-value / density gradient — how a value (land price, people per km²) changes with distance from the city centre.
Example: Lagos — a congestion index that spikes at rush hour because road growth lags far behind car ownership. Barcelona — pollution falling inside its 'superblocks' where through-traffic is removed. Singapore — a road-pricing graph showing traffic drop as the congestion charge rises. Reading any of these is the same skill as reading the Marisport figure above — find the axis, read the value, quote it with its unit.

✅ Quick self-check

Tap each card to reveal the answer.

In what order is a grid reference read? Eastings first (read across), northings second (read up) — 'along the corridor, then up the stairs'. For a six-figure reference, find the square, then estimate tenths across and up.

How do you turn a map distance into kilometres? Use the scale. At 1:50 000, 1 cm = 0.5 km, so multiply the measured cm by 0.5. At 1:25 000, multiply by 0.25. (4 cm at 1:50 000 = 2 km.)

How do you read a compass direction from A to B? Stand at A and face B; read N/NE/E/SE/S/SW/W/NW from the way you must travel. Straight across to the right is east (E); directly below is south (S).

What does a graph read need to score? The exact value with its unit off the correct axis — or, for a difference, the subtraction of two peak values. A vague trend word alone scores nothing.

What does a top [10] essay using these skills need? Weigh what maps and graphs reveal against their limits, anchor it to a named city (Lagos, Singapore), use accurate skills terms, and judge that they describe but do not explain congestion.


🎯 Highest-yield exam reminders

Exam Tips

  • Option G is on PAPER 1 — answer only the options you studied (SL does 2, HL does 3); the skills feed both the structured questions and the [10] essay.
  • Order matters: eastings before northings, square before tenths (six-figure).
  • Direction = stand at the start, face the end (N/NE/E...); scale 1:50 000 -> x 0.5 km per cm, 1:25 000 -> x 0.25.
  • Graph: read the value, subtract two peaks for a difference, or describe the trend WITH figures — never a bare trend word.
  • Every skills mark needs the EXACT figure WITH its unit (km, grid digits, the index value).
  • On the [10] essay, use the data you read but go further — weigh what maps and graphs reveal against their limits and judge that they describe rather than explain.
